minishell/parser/static/small_parse_table/small_parse_table_1815.c
2024-04-28 19:59:01 +02:00

140 lines
4.2 KiB
C

/* ************************************************************************** */
/* */
/* ::: :::::::: */
/* small_parse_table_1815.c :+: :+: :+: */
/* +:+ +:+ +:+ */
/* By: maiboyer <maiboyer@student.42.fr> +#+ +:+ +#+ */
/* +#+#+#+#+#+ +#+ */
/* Created: 2024/04/14 19:17:54 by maiboyer #+# #+# */
/* Updated: 2024/04/14 19:18:20 by maiboyer ### ########.fr */
/* */
/* ************************************************************************** */
#include "./small_parse_table.h"
void small_parse_table_9075(t_small_parse_table_array *v)
{
v->a[181500] = anon_sym_STAR_STAR;
v->a[181501] = actions(7597);
v->a[181502] = 1;
v->a[181503] = anon_sym_EQ_TILDE;
v->a[181504] = actions(7599);
v->a[181505] = 1;
v->a[181506] = anon_sym_QMARK;
v->a[181507] = actions(7569);
v->a[181508] = 2;
v->a[181509] = anon_sym_PLUS_PLUS;
v->a[181510] = anon_sym_DASH_DASH;
v->a[181511] = actions(7583);
v->a[181512] = 2;
v->a[181513] = anon_sym_EQ_EQ;
v->a[181514] = anon_sym_BANG_EQ;
v->a[181515] = actions(7585);
v->a[181516] = 2;
v->a[181517] = anon_sym_LT;
v->a[181518] = anon_sym_GT;
v->a[181519] = actions(7587);
small_parse_table_9076(v);
}
void small_parse_table_9076(t_small_parse_table_array *v)
{
v->a[181520] = 2;
v->a[181521] = anon_sym_LT_EQ;
v->a[181522] = anon_sym_GT_EQ;
v->a[181523] = actions(7589);
v->a[181524] = 2;
v->a[181525] = anon_sym_LT_LT;
v->a[181526] = anon_sym_GT_GT;
v->a[181527] = actions(7591);
v->a[181528] = 2;
v->a[181529] = anon_sym_PLUS;
v->a[181530] = anon_sym_DASH;
v->a[181531] = actions(7593);
v->a[181532] = 3;
v->a[181533] = anon_sym_STAR;
v->a[181534] = anon_sym_SLASH;
v->a[181535] = anon_sym_PERCENT;
v->a[181536] = actions(7571);
v->a[181537] = 11;
v->a[181538] = anon_sym_PLUS_EQ;
v->a[181539] = anon_sym_DASH_EQ;
small_parse_table_9077(v);
}
void small_parse_table_9077(t_small_parse_table_array *v)
{
v->a[181540] = anon_sym_STAR_EQ;
v->a[181541] = anon_sym_SLASH_EQ;
v->a[181542] = anon_sym_PERCENT_EQ;
v->a[181543] = anon_sym_STAR_STAR_EQ;
v->a[181544] = anon_sym_LT_LT_EQ;
v->a[181545] = anon_sym_GT_GT_EQ;
v->a[181546] = anon_sym_AMP_EQ;
v->a[181547] = anon_sym_CARET_EQ;
v->a[181548] = anon_sym_PIPE_EQ;
v->a[181549] = 19;
v->a[181550] = actions(71);
v->a[181551] = 1;
v->a[181552] = sym_comment;
v->a[181553] = actions(7110);
v->a[181554] = 1;
v->a[181555] = anon_sym_RBRACK;
v->a[181556] = actions(7567);
v->a[181557] = 1;
v->a[181558] = anon_sym_EQ;
v->a[181559] = actions(7573);
small_parse_table_9078(v);
}
void small_parse_table_9078(t_small_parse_table_array *v)
{
v->a[181560] = 1;
v->a[181561] = anon_sym_PIPE_PIPE;
v->a[181562] = actions(7575);
v->a[181563] = 1;
v->a[181564] = anon_sym_AMP_AMP;
v->a[181565] = actions(7577);
v->a[181566] = 1;
v->a[181567] = anon_sym_PIPE;
v->a[181568] = actions(7579);
v->a[181569] = 1;
v->a[181570] = anon_sym_CARET;
v->a[181571] = actions(7581);
v->a[181572] = 1;
v->a[181573] = anon_sym_AMP;
v->a[181574] = actions(7595);
v->a[181575] = 1;
v->a[181576] = anon_sym_STAR_STAR;
v->a[181577] = actions(7597);
v->a[181578] = 1;
v->a[181579] = anon_sym_EQ_TILDE;
small_parse_table_9079(v);
}
void small_parse_table_9079(t_small_parse_table_array *v)
{
v->a[181580] = actions(7599);
v->a[181581] = 1;
v->a[181582] = anon_sym_QMARK;
v->a[181583] = actions(7569);
v->a[181584] = 2;
v->a[181585] = anon_sym_PLUS_PLUS;
v->a[181586] = anon_sym_DASH_DASH;
v->a[181587] = actions(7583);
v->a[181588] = 2;
v->a[181589] = anon_sym_EQ_EQ;
v->a[181590] = anon_sym_BANG_EQ;
v->a[181591] = actions(7585);
v->a[181592] = 2;
v->a[181593] = anon_sym_LT;
v->a[181594] = anon_sym_GT;
v->a[181595] = actions(7587);
v->a[181596] = 2;
v->a[181597] = anon_sym_LT_EQ;
v->a[181598] = anon_sym_GT_EQ;
v->a[181599] = actions(7589);
small_parse_table_9080(v);
}
/* EOF small_parse_table_1815.c */